Meeting notes — Infra sync, Thursday. Branch office at Marlow Point still running the failed Veridon unit on a loaner chassis. Replacement server (Oxbridge R4, pre-imaged by the Calverton bench team) is boxed and signed off. Records team to log serial transfer once delivery confirms. Downtime window agreed with branch lead Petra Osmun: Saturday 06:00–09:00. Old unit returns for secure disposal the same run. No remote handling — physical swap only. The courier hand-over must follow the confidential instruction below.

handover note for hahaf-kagap: the julok istmir courier leaves the julmir ralix briius fenmir istael druiel kelax gilath ledger at gate 3239 under passcode 889722

Handover Note — Expansion into the Veldmark Region

To all branch managers: as I transfer duties to Director Ansel Roque, please note that the Veldmark expansion remains on schedule. Lease negotiations for the first three branches are complete, staffing plans approved, and supplier contracts under legal review. Direct operational questions to Ansel going forward. The confidential planning note follows below.

board note of baweg-bawig: Project Tamath slips by six weeks because of the audit delay.

To the release manager: I'm passing ownership of the Pellwick deep-link router to Sorrel before the 4.2 cut. The intent-matching table now lives in the Farrowgate config service; stale entries were purged last sprint. Watch the fallback route — it silently swallows malformed slugs, which inflated our drop-off metrics in March. The staging resolver needs its keystore unlocked before each regression pass, and that keystore accepts only one credential. For the signing vault, the recovery phrase is noted directly below.

recovery phrase for tafog-fafog: novix-novdor-fraath-brieth-olieth-oliix-rusix-wenion-julax-druox